Created attachment 306621 [details] Issue in IOS 10.3 with text-align:justify Open the page http://codepen.io/shmdhussain/pen/dvxoNy?editors=1100 in IOS 10.3 Safari In the Page, I used paragraph with RTL texts and used justify alignment using css property text-align: justify In Safari 10.3 text is overflowing, looks like breaking the layout see the screenshot - 1 below In all the previous versions of IOS safari prior to 10.3 is working fine see the screenshot - 2 below When text:align:right is used in IOS 10.3 page is working fine, see this page http://codepen.io/shmdhussain/pen/aJeOVr see screenshot-3 below See this Code Pen http://codepen.io/shmdhussain/pen/jBgPzx for More Detailed Info About this Bug
